Understanding Rubber Adhesives

Rubber adhesives, also known as elastomeric adhesives, are a class of adhesives designed to bond rubber and elastomeric materials, as well as other substrates like metal, plastic, and fabric. These adhesives are formulated to provide flexibility, resilience, and high bond strength, making them ideal for applications where the bonded surfaces are subjected to vibration, impact, or extreme temperatures.

Types of Rubber Adhesives

Rubber adhesives are available in various types to cater to different bonding requirements:

  • Natural Rubber Adhesives: Derived from the latex of rubber trees, natural rubber adhesives offer excellent tack and bond strength, making them suitable for applications in the footwear, automotive, and construction industries.
  • Synthetic Rubber Adhesives: These adhesives are manufactured from synthetic rubber polymers such as neoprene, nitrile, and butyl rubber. They exhibit superior resistance to oil, chemicals, and weathering, making them well-suited for demanding industrial applications.
  • Pressure-Sensitive Rubber Adhesives: These adhesives create a bond upon the application of pressure without the need for heat or solvents. They are commonly used in labels, tapes, and graphic applications.
  • Heat-Cured Rubber Adhesives: Designed to cure at elevated temperatures, these adhesives provide high bond strength and heat resistance, making them suitable for bonding rubber components in automotive and aerospace applications.

Key Properties of Rubber Adhesives

Rubber adhesives exhibit a unique set of properties that make them stand out in industrial applications:

  • Flexibility: Rubber adhesives offer flexibility, allowing bonded materials to move without compromising the bond strength. This property is critical in applications where dynamic loads or vibrations are present.
  • High Bond Strength: These adhesives provide strong and durable bonds, ensuring reliable performance in various environments and operating conditions.
  • Chemical Resistance: Some rubber adhesives offer excellent resistance to chemicals, oils, and solvents, making them suitable for applications where exposure to harsh substances is a concern.
  • Temperature Resistance: Certain rubber adhesives exhibit high temperature resistance, maintaining their bond strength even under extreme heat or cold conditions.
  • Weather Resistance: Synthetic rubber adhesives are known for their excellent weathering properties, making them ideal for outdoor applications.

Applications of Rubber Adhesives

Rubber adhesives find a wide range of applications across different industries due to their versatile properties:

  • Automotive Industry: These adhesives are used for bonding rubber seals, gaskets, weather stripping, and vibration dampening components in vehicles, contributing to noise reduction and improved vehicle performance.
  • Construction Sector: Rubber adhesives play a key role in bonding rubber flooring, roofing membranes, and insulation materials, providing durable and weather-resistant connections in building structures.
  • Electronics Manufacturing: These adhesives are utilized for bonding rubber gaskets, seals, and insulation materials in electronic devices and components, ensuring reliable performance and protection against environmental factors.
  • Footwear Production: Rubber adhesives are essential for bonding rubber outsoles, insoles, and components in the footwear industry, offering strong and flexible connections in various types of shoes and boots.
  • Aerospace Applications: Rubber adhesives are employed for bonding rubber components in aircraft interiors, exteriors, and engine systems, providing crucial sealing and vibration dampening functions in demanding aerospace environments.
